06/01/2026
Cadet Highlight! Cadet Price spent the last two weeks at Fort Drum with his unit, A Co., 572nd BEB, conducting their annual training. While there, he participated in heavy demolition and served as OPFOR for the infantry, executing both defensive and offensive lanes. He also had the opportunity to compete for and earn the prestigious German Armed Forces Proficiency Badge.

05/11/2026
Congratulations to our newly commissioned 2LTs!
On May 8, 2026, Syracuse University Army ROTC commissioned 24 new Second Lieutenants at our Spring Commissioning Ceremony. There, they received their 2LT rank, commission from the United States Army, and their first salute from an NCO of their choosing. Congratulations to the Class of 2026!

04/22/2026
CFTX!
This semester, Stalwart Battalion conducted its annual CFTX alongside Clarkson and Cornell. CDTs from all three programs worked together to conduct tactical lanes in preparation for CST this summer.
